ऋग्वेद ९.१०१.१५

Ṛgveda 9.101.15

ṛṣi
ऋ. १-३ अन्धीगुः श्यावाश्विः, .......

sa vī̱ro da̍kṣa̱sādha̍no̱ vi yasta̱stambha̱ roda̍sī |hari̍ḥ pa̱vitre̍ avyata ve̱dhā na yoni̍mā̱sada̍m ||

Transliteration IAST

sa vī̱ro da̍kṣa̱sādha̍no̱ vi yasta̱stambha̱ roda̍sī | hari̍ḥ pa̱vitre̍ avyata ve̱dhā na yoni̍mā̱sada̍m ||

Padapāṭha word by word, as recited

सः | वीरः | दक्ष-साधनः | वि | यः | तस्तम्भ | रोदसी इति | हरिः | पवित्रे | अव्यत | वेधाः | न | योनिम् | आसदम्

saḥ | vīraḥ | dakṣa-sādhanaḥ | vi | yaḥ | tastambha | rodasī iti | hariḥ | pavitre | avyata | vedhāḥ | na | yonim | āsadam

Translations signed

That Hero who produces strength, he who hath propped both worlds apart, Gold-hued, hath wrapped him in the sieve, to settle, priest-like, in his place.

Ralph T.H. GriffithThe Hymns of the Rigveda, translated with a popular commentary, 1896 · public domain
